What are off-road trainers?
- Off-road trainers are specially designed footwear for outdoor activities such as trail running, hiking, and trekking. They typically feature rugged outsoles for enhanced grip, durable materials for protection, and breathable fabrics for comfort during extended wear.
How do I choose the right off-road trainers?
- When selecting off-road trainers, consider the type of terrain you'll be navigating, the level of cushioning you prefer, and the fit that suits your foot shape. Look for features like waterproofing if you expect wet conditions, and ensure the trainers provide adequate support for your ankles.
Can off-road trainers be used for everyday wear?
- Yes, off-road trainers can be worn for everyday activities, especially if you enjoy a sporty or casual style. Their comfort and durability make them suitable for various casual outings, but they are specifically engineered for outdoor performance.
Are off-road trainers waterproof?
- Many off-road trainers come with waterproof features, but not all models are designed this way. If you plan to encounter wet conditions, look for trainers that specify waterproof or water-resistant materials to keep your feet dry during your adventures.
What activities are off-road trainers best suited for?
- Off-road trainers are ideal for a variety of outdoor activities, including trail running, hiking, and walking on uneven surfaces. They provide the necessary support and traction for navigating challenging terrains, making them a great choice for outdoor enthusiasts.
How should off-road trainers fit?
- Off-road trainers should fit snugly but comfortably, allowing for some wiggle room in the toes. It's important to ensure that your heel is secure in the shoe to prevent slipping, while still providing enough space to accommodate swelling during long activities.
